Kerala is plant-based by tradition, not by trend. Sadya feasts arrive on banana leaves, Ayurvedic kitchens cook to your constitution, and the backwaters drift past coconut groves and spice gardens.

It is a place to slow down — houseboat mornings, long lunches, oil massages — where almost every plate is already vegetarian and much of it naturally vegan.

On the table

Signature plant-based plates.

01

Sadya

A banana-leaf feast of a dozen-plus vegetable dishes.

02

Avial

Mixed vegetables in coconut and curry leaf.

03

Appam & stew

Lacy rice pancakes with a gentle vegetable stew.

04

Olan

Ash gourd and coconut milk, barely spiced.
